I have standard Parnell LPG on my duel fuel EF. Once I started adding mods I noticed the restriction on fuel intake and therefore loss of power.
Quite disappointed but I love the convenience of dual fuel.

I am looking at gas injection, has anyone got it, how much and have you had any problems? How long have you had it and whats the after market sales support like?

There doesn't seem too many people that manufacture the systems that deliver it. Theres 2 types of systems???????, one of them looked like the gas is injected into the manifold.
REALLY WANT TO KNOW MORE.
There seems alot of HUGE promises and opinions out there.
